Human ZKSCAN3 and Drosophila M1BP are functionally homologous transcription factors in autophagy regulation

Abstract: Autophagy is an essential cellular process that maintains homeostasis by recycling damaged organelles and nutrients during development and cellular stress. ZKSCAN3 is the sole identified master transcriptional repressor of autophagy in human cell lines. How… read more here.

Motif 1 Binding Protein suppresses wingless to promote eye fate in Drosophila

Abstract: The phenomenon of RNA polymerase II (Pol II) pausing at transcription start site (TSS) is one of the key rate-limiting steps in regulating genome-wide gene expression. In Drosophila embryo, Pol II pausing is known to… read more here.
